This guide will walk you through key elements of 1930s design, ensuring your bedroom reflects the timeless beauty of that decade.Understanding 1930s Decor: Key CharacteristicsThe 1930s was a time of innovation in interior design. Key features of this era included rich colors, bold patterns, and a mix of traditional and modern styles. Think about using geometric patterns and luxurious fabrics to create a sense of sophistication.Colors from this period were often deep and moody, with shades like navy blue, burgundy, and forest green dominating the palette. Incorporating these colors into your bedroom can instantly transport you back in time.Furniture Choices for a 1930s BedroomWhen it comes to furniture, opt for pieces that showcase craftsmanship and design. Look for items made from dark woods, such as mahogany or walnut, which were popular during this time. Vintage or reproduction furniture with Art Deco influences can evoke the era beautifully.Don’t forget to include a statement piece, like a lavish bed frame or an ornate dresser, to anchor the room. A classic vanity with a round mirror can also add a touch of glamour.Textiles and Accessories: Adding the Finishing TouchesTextiles play a crucial role in achieving the authentic 1930s look. Consider using heavy drapes, plush rugs, and patterned bed linens. Floral prints and geometric designs were very much in vogue during this period, so don’t shy away from mixing patterns!Accessorize your space with vintage finds like lamps, artwork, and decorative mirrors.
